Saskatchewan Roughriders Football Club, Thaddeus Coleman, Josiah St. John and Jabari Hunt fined following Week 6

TORONTO (August 3, 2016) -- The Canadian Football League (CFL) announced today:

The Saskatchewan Roughriders Football Club was fined $15,000 for an in-game roster violation related to deployment of international players in their game played on July 16, 2016 versus the BC Lions.

Saskatchewan Roughrider Thaddeus Coleman was fined for a dangerous block on Montreal Alouettes defensive lineman Aaron Lavarias.

Saskatchewan Roughrider Josiah St. John was fined for a chop block on Montreal Alouettes defensive lineman Vaughn Martin.

Edmonton Eskimo Jabari Hunt was fined for a low hit to Winnipeg Blue Bombers quarterback Matt Nichols.

As per league policy, the amount of the player fines was not disclosed.
